编程键盘键值是什么

不及物动词 其他 23

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程键盘的键值是用来表示键盘上每个按键的唯一标识符。通过键值,我们可以在编程中识别和处理特定的按键输入。不同的编程语言和操作系统可能会使用不同的键值表示方法,下面我将以常见的编程语言和操作系统为例进行说明。

    1. C语言:
      在C语言中,键值一般是用ASCII码表示的。ASCII码是一种字符编码标准,它将每个字符映射到一个唯一的整数值。例如,字符'A'对应的ASCII码为65,字符'a'对应的ASCII码为97。当我们在C语言中使用键盘输入函数如getch()或者getchar()时,可以获取到用户输入的键值。

    2. Java:
      在Java中,键值通常是由KeyEvent类表示的。每个按键都有一个对应的唯一的整数值。可以使用KeyEvent类中定义的常量来表示不同的按键,例如KeyEvent.VK_A表示按下了键盘上的字母'A'键。

    3. Python:
      在Python中,可以使用keyboard模块来获取键盘输入。键值是通过keyboard模块中定义的常量来表示的,比如keyboard.KEY_A表示按下了字母'A'键。

    4. Windows操作系统:
      在Windows操作系统中,每个按键都有一个唯一的虚拟键值(Virtual Key Code)。虚拟键值是一个由整数表示的标识符,它可以用来识别和处理按键事件。在Windows编程中,可以使用GetAsyncKeyState()函数来获取键盘输入的虚拟键值。

    5. macOS操作系统:
      在macOS操作系统中,键值是通过NSEvent类表示的。每个按键都有一个对应的唯一的整数值,可以使用NSEvent类中定义的常量来表示不同的按键,例如NSEvent.keyCodeA表示按下了字母'A'键。

    总结:编程键盘键值是用来表示键盘上每个按键的唯一标识符,在不同的编程语言和操作系统中,键值的表示方法可能会有所差异,但基本原理是相同的。通过键值,我们可以在编程中判断和处理用户的按键输入。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程键盘(Programming Keyboard)是一种专为程序员和开发人员设计的键盘,其布局和功能被优化以提高编程效率。编程键盘通常具有许多自定义按键和特殊功能,以帮助用户更快速、更方便地编写代码。

    编程键盘上的键值(Key Values)指的是不同按键所代表的字符或功能。下面是一些常见的编程键盘键值:

    1. 字母和数字键:编程键盘上包含所有标准的字母和数字键,用于输入代码中的变量名、函数名和数字。

    2. 特殊字符键:编程键盘上还包含许多特殊字符键,如加号、减号、星号、斜杠、百分比符号等,用于编写算术运算、逻辑运算和字符串操作。

    3. 控制键:编程键盘上的控制键用于控制光标的移动和文本的选择。其中包括箭头键、Home键、End键、Page Up键、Page Down键等。

    4. 功能键:编程键盘上的功能键通常被用于执行特定的操作或命令,如保存文件、打开终端、调试代码等。常见的功能键有F1-F12键。

    5. 自定义按键:编程键盘还可以具有一些自定义按键,用户可以根据自己的需求进行设定。这些自定义按键可以用于放置常用的代码片段、快速执行命令或模拟特定的鼠标点击操作,以提高编程效率。

    总的来说,编程键盘的键值是多样化的,用户可以根据自己的需要进行自定义设置,以适应不同的编程需求和个人操作习惯。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程键盘是用于编程或游戏的特殊键盘,其键值与普通键盘上的行标准键盘有所不同。编程键盘上的键值通常可以通过软件进行自定义,以满足程序员或游戏玩家的需求。下面将对编程键盘的键值进行详细解释。

    1. 常见的编程键盘键值
      编程键盘通常具有一些常见的键值,包括但不限于以下几种:
      1.1 功能键:常见的功能键包括 Esc、F1-F12 等,这些键通常用于快速执行特定的命令或功能。
      1.2 方向键:方向键通常用于在文本编辑器、代码编辑器或游戏中控制光标的移动。方向键包括上、下、左、右箭头键。
      1.3 转义键:转义键通常用于将特殊字符或命令插入到终端或编程环境中。常见的转义键包括 Tab、Enter、Insert、Delete、Home、End、Page Up、Page Down 等。
      1.4 控制键:控制键通常用于与其他键组合使用,以执行特定的命令或功能。常见的控制键包括 Ctrl、Alt、Shift 等。
      1.5 功能区键:功能区键通常位于键盘的上方,用于执行特定的功能或快捷方式。常见的功能键包括音量调节、亮度调节、播放/暂停、上一曲/下一曲等。
      1.6 宏键:宏键是一种编程键盘独有的功能,它允许用户将一系列命令或按键记录下来,并通过按下单个按键来自动执行这些命令。宏键通常用于提高编程或游戏的效率。

    2. 自定义键值
      编程键盘的一个重要特点是可以通过软件进行自定义,使用户能够为每个按键分配特定的命令或功能。常见的编程键盘软件包括:
      2.1 QMK:QMK 是一种开源固件,可以将编程键盘转化为个性化的输入设备。通过 QMK,用户可以定义每个按键的键值、层级、宏等。
      2.2 AutoHotkey:AutoHotkey 是一种功能强大的自动化脚本编写工具,可以为编程键盘的每个按键编写自定义脚本,实现各种定制化需求。
      2.3 iCUE:iCUE 是 Corsair 推出的一个软件套件,可以为 Corsair 编程键盘设置特定的键值、宏等。
      2.4 EliteKeyboards:EliteKeyboards 是一个在线商店,提供各种编程键盘和键盘配件,用户可以通过其网站进行各种自定义设置和购买。

    3. 操作流程
      具体的操作流程可能因不同的编程键盘和软件而有所不同,但一般的操作流程如下:
      3.1 下载并安装相应的软件,如 QMK、AutoHotkey 等。
      3.2 连接编程键盘到计算机,并确保已正确安装驱动程序。
      3.3 打开软件,并根据软件的指引选择或创建一个新的配置文件。
      3.4 在配置文件中选择 or 创建一个自定义的键盘布局。
      3.5 为每个按键分配特定的键值、功能或宏。
      3.6 保存配置文件,并将其上传到编程键盘上。
      3.7 测试编程键盘的键值和功能是否正常,必要时进行调整和修改。

    需要注意的是,不同的编程键盘和软件可能具有不同的操作界面和设置选项,因此在使用编程键盘之前,建议查看相关的用户手册或参考资料,以获得更详细的操作说明。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部